Publisher Description

This book is dedicated to the analysis of parametric amplification with special emphasis on the MOS discrete-time implementation. This implementation is demonstrated by the presentation of several circuits where the MOS parametric amplifier cell is used: small gain amplifier, comparator with embedded pre-amplification, discrete-time mixer/IIR-Filter, and analog-to-digital converter (ADC).  Experimental results are shown to validate the overall design technique.
Provides the complete theoretical analysis, supported by electrical simulations, of the parametric amplification technique in both continuous time and discrete time domains;Describes the design flow of an ADC fully based on discrete-time parametric amplification in CMOS technology;Presents a high speed time-interleaved pipeline ADC, based on parametric MOS amplification techniques described, complementing theory discussed with experimental results.
